Xiaoti Wang (王小梯) has been competing for 10 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 15.37, set at Xuchang Open 2017, puts him in the top 25.7%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 9,641st in China. Across 2 competitions since June 2016, he has put 15 official solves on the record across one event. His 3×3 best has come down from 19.38 in June 2016 to 15.37, a 21% improvement.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
